Overview
- Released on Feb. 20, the album features Kendrick Lamar on “Good Flirts” and “House Money,” with additional appearances by Too $hort, Momo Boyd, and Che Ecru.
- HotNewHipHop reports the project earned 13.8 million Spotify streams on day one, marking Baby Keem’s biggest debut on the platform to date.
- The rollout included a multi-part Booman documentary series—where Kendrick praised Keem’s evolution—and a livestreamed Los Angeles listening party that featured a surprise Too $hort cameo.
- Early reaction highlights Keem’s growth and personal storytelling, with active debate over Kendrick’s guest turns and inconsistent reporting on the track count (11 or 12) for a roughly 36–38 minute runtime.
- A Live Nation-produced Ca$ino Tour begins April 15 in Raleigh before moving through North America and then Europe and the U.K. later in the year.
